Turkey Deploys Thousands of Troops Against P.K.K.

Thursday, October 20th, 2011

Turkey’s offensive is one of its largest military operation in years, with 10,000 troops backed by warplanes pursuing rebels in southeastern Turkey and northern Iraq.

DealBook: Qualcomm to Buy Atheros for $45 a Share

Wednesday, January 5th, 2011

In its largest acquisition ever, Qualcomm is buying the semiconductor manufacturer Atheros Communications in a deal that values the company at $3.1 billion.
